I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S
The safety instructions below will tell you how to use your dehumidifier to avoid harm to yourself
or damage to your dehumidifier.
FOR YOUR SAFETY
Do not store or use gasoline or other
flammable vapors and liquids in the vicinity of
this or any other appliance. Read product
labels for flammability and other warnings.
PREVENT ACCIDENTS
To reduce the risk of fire, electrical shock, or
injuryto persons when using your
dehumidifier, follow basic precautions,
includingthe following:
Be sure the electrical service is adequate for
the model you have chosen.
_ Avoid fire hazard or electric shock.
Do not use an extension cord or an adapter plug.
Do not remove any prong from the power cord.

ELECTRICAL INFORMATION
The complete electrical rating of your new
dehumidifier is stated on the serial plate. Refer
to the rating when checking the electrical
requirements.
Be sure the dehumidifier is properly
grounded. To minimize shock and fire
hazards, proper grounding is important. The
power cord is equipped with a three-prong
grounding plug for protection against shock
hazards.
Your dehumidifier must be used in a properly
grounded wall receptacle. If the wall
receptacle you intend to use is not
adequately grounded or protected by a time
delay fuse or circuit breaker, have a qualified
electrician install the proper receptacle.
Do not use an extension cord or an
adapter plug.
